**Ticket: RestockPilot drift between planner nodes**

New folks: RestockPilot, our vending-machine restock planner, is producing different route plans in prod vs. the replay environment. Cause is config drift — someone hot-patched demand-forecast weights on two planner nodes during the Harrowgate outage and never backported the change. Plans now disagree on bin thresholds and truck capacity. Fix is to re-sync all nodes from the canonical config, then rerun yesterday's plan as a check. The canonical values are below.

deployment values, yahag-tawef:
ZORWYN_HOST=zorwyn.tolvaqlabs.internal
ZORWYN_PORT=9300

Ticket: Firmware vault locked — Brightling update channel

The signing vault for the Brightling device-firmware update channel auto-sealed after three failed unlock attempts during last night's staging push. Until it is re-opened, no firmware bundles can be signed or promoted to the beta ring. Future maintainers: do not force-reset the seal counter; that wipes the channel keys permanently. Follow the documented unseal flow in the Brightling ops handbook, step 4. The recovery passphrase for the unseal ceremony is recorded below.

unlock words, hahip-yagef: zorok-novmir-zorix-silax

## Onboarding: tailcat CLI

tailcat is our internal CLI for tailing logs from the Fennwick aggregation tier. Install it from the Brindlehaus package mirror, then run `tailcat init` to generate a local config. Streams are filtered server-side, so always pass `--service` to avoid pulling the full firehose. Maintainers should note that retention on the hot tier is 48 hours; anything older must come from cold storage via `tailcat fetch`. Authentication against the Fennwick gateway requires the key below.

app token of fahap-kaguf = qvz23-OdXvKazTsFDg6u2yCrzom7i

Hey Marisol — handing off GridWeaver before I'm out. The crossword generator is stable, but the clue-dedup job on staging sometimes wedges after midnight; just restart the worker, it's idempotent. Puzzle exports to the Lintbury CDN are fine. One thing: if the admin vault locks you out while rotating the seed dictionary, you'll need the recovery passphrase to reopen it. I've left it right below so you're not stuck.

recovery phrase for kahof-hawif: holok-julvan-eliax-ulaath-briath